Most pencil cores are made of graphite powder mixed with a clay binder. Graphite pencils (traditionally known as "lead pencils") produce grey or black marks that are easily erased, but otherwise resistant to moisture, most solvents, ultraviolet radiation and natural aging.
From the 16th century, all pencils were made with leads of English natural graphite, but modern pencil lead is most commonly a mix of powdered graphite and clay; it was invented by Nicolas-Jacques Conté in 1795. A copying pencil, also an indelible pencil or chemical pencil, [1] is a pencil whose lead contains a dye. The lead is fabricated by adding a dry water-soluble permanent dye to powdered graphite—used in standard graphite pencils—before binding the mixture with clay. [2] [3]
